#### Understanding Targeted Acquisitions
Targeted acquisitions involve selecting specific players based on their skills, potential, and fit within the team's tactical philosophy. These clubs recognize that not every player is suitable for every role or matches the entire team’s vision. By focusing on individual talents, they can build a more cohesive and effective squad.
